# Monthly partitioning for the Ledgerbay events table.
#
# Partitions are created ahead of time by the maintenance job and
# dropped once they age past the retention window. Creating them
# early avoids insert failures at month rollover; keeping a few
# trailing months covers late-arriving events. Reviewers should
# confirm any change here matches the retention policy doc.
# The scheduling constants are defined below.

limits module of tawep-hawif:
WEIGHTS = {
    "sordor": 228,
    "kasax": 458,
    "ulaox": 8,
    "casix": 495,
    "briix": 335,
}

Welcome. CrashCourier ingests mobile crash reports from the Fennel app and routes symbolicated traces to your plugin's topic. Plugins are sandboxed: read-only access to trace payloads, no raw device data. Register your plugin manifest, pick a topic, and you'll receive staged test crashes within minutes. Rate limits apply per topic; bursts are buffered for one hour. If your staging credentials lock after failed handshakes, use the self-service recovery console. It will ask for the shared recovery passphrase, shown below for registered authors.

strongbox words: kelax-ralok-praix-lamox-goriel-ralir-fendor-gileth-jordor-gorwyn-aldax-oliix-rusiel

Capacity note for the PantryScale recipe calculator. Traffic peaks Sunday evenings when meal-prep users batch-convert recipes; conversions are CPU-light but cache-heavy, so memory headroom matters more than cores. We provision for 3x median load and shed ingredient-image requests first under pressure. Before touching autoscaling on the Fernhollow cluster, review the current tuning constants, which are listed here.

tuning constants:
QUOTAS = {
    "druwyn": 5,
    "holix": 5,
    "zorath": 5,
    "holwyn": 10,
}

Subject: Reminder job v2 rollout

Team — the Medlark clinic appointment reminder job shipped to prod this morning. Send window now respects patient time zones; the old UTC batching is gone. Watch the Quietwood dashboard for bounce spikes through Friday. Rollback is one flag flip, no migration. Build token for this release follows below.

session token of yajof-bagef = htk4_937d